WARNING
■When driving on slippery road surfaces
Be careful of downshifting and sudden acceleration, as this could result in
the vehicle skidding to the side or spinning.
■ To prevent an accident when releasing the shift lock
Before pressing the shift lock override button, make sure to set the parking
brake and depress the brake pedal.
If the accelerator pedal is accidentally depressed instead of the brake pedal
when the shift lock override button is pressed and the shift lever is shifted
out of P, the vehicle may suddenly start, possibly leading to an accident
resulting in death or serious injury.

■ Operation of iMT
● When the clutch pedal is depressed and the shift lever is moved to a posi-
tion, iMT controls the engine speed to be optimal for changing the shift posi-
tion. However, iMT stops operating before the shift position is changed if the
clutch pedal is not released for a while, and the engine speed cannot be
controlled. To operate iMT again, depress the clutch pedal and operate the
shift lever.
● The engine speed may be increased when the clutch pedal is depressed,
However, this does not indicate a malfunction.

■ When iMT does not operate
In the following situations, iMT may not operate. However, this does not indi-
cate a malfunction.
● The shift lever is not operated for a long time after the clutch pedal is
depressed.
● The vehicle moves for a while after the shift lever is shifted to N and the
clutch pedal is released, and then the clutch pedal is depressed and the
shift lever is moved to a position.
● The clutch pedal is not completely released and depressed again
● The clutch pedal is not fully depressed
■ If the warning message for iMT is shown on the multi-information dis-
play
iMT may be malfunctioning and the function is disabled. Have the vehicle
inspected by any authorized Toyota retailer or Toyota authorized repairer, or
any reliable repairer.
WARNING
■ Gear Shift Indicator display
For safety, the driver should not look only at the display. Refer to the display
when it is safe to do so while considering actual traffic and road conditions.
Failure to do so may lead to an accident.
■ Limitations of the iMT
iMT is not a system that prevents shift lever operation error or engine over-
revving.
Depending on the situation, iMT may not operate normally and the shift
position may not be changed smoothly. Overly relying on iMT may cause an
unexpected accident.

NOTICE
■To prevent damage to the transmission
● Do not lift up the ring section except when shifting the lever to R.
● Shift the shift lever to R only when the vehicle is stationary.
●Do not shift the shift lever to R without
depressing the clutch pedal.
